[sisyphus] g77

Stanislav Ievlev =?iso-8859-1?q?inger_=CE=C1_altlinux=2Eorg?=
Пт Апр 23 11:38:54 MSD 2004


On Fri, Apr 23, 2004 at 10:28:07AM +0400, Epiphanov Sergei wrote:
> Собираю проект на Фортране с применением g77 3.3 и обнаруживаю, что 
> полученная программа неработоспособна. В программе идут только разные 
> алгебраические уравнения и там, где число не должно изменяться - меняется. 
> При трасировке программы обнаружил, что нужная переменная становится вдруг 
> NaN, хотя если пройтись по всей программе и ручками посчитать, то величина 
> должна быть неизменной.
> 
> При сборке компилятором Intel Fortran Compiler 6.0 тех же самых исходных 
> текстов всё работает нормально.
> 
> Есть предположение, что это связано с переменными с неопределенным типом.
Очень сомневаюсь, что виноват g77. Ищите memory corruption.
При сборке разными компиляторами данная проблема может проявляться по
разному.
> 
> -- 
> С уважением, Епифанов Сергей

> _______________________________________________
> Sisyphus mailing list
> Sisyphus на altlinux.ru
> http://lists.altlinux.ru/mailman/listinfo/sisyphus




Подробная информация о списке рассылки Sisyphus